Jazeera Airways spreads its wings of freedom to Dubai

Jazeera Airways, the airline that brings freedom to travelers, made its first landing in Dubai International Airport at 21:15 yesterday.

Mohamed Bin Sulayem, Middle East car racing champion, opened the plane doors to welcome passengers who made the milestone trip and who greeted him carrying the national flags of Kuwait and the UAE.

Jazeera Airways, launches its operations with flights to 5 destinations in the Middle East, these being: Dubai, Beirut, Amman, Damascus, Bahrain, and will be adding Alexandria, Luxor and the Indian Subcontinent in the near future. Jazeera Airways flight number J9-16 will be flying daily to Dubai arriving at 21:15 and back to Kuwait on flight J9-17 departing at 22:00.

"Dubai was strategically chosen to be Jazeera Airways' first destination and is one of the most traveled to cities in the region,"


said Marwan Boodai, Chairman and CEO of Jazeera Airways.

"We foresee major traffic to dubai and have scheduled daily flights in order to provide flexibility to frequent travelers."

The airline is the first in the Middle East to give passengers complete control of their travel plans through a variety of booking channels including internet, a call center based in Dubai and local travel agents.

Jazeera Airways is the first privately owned airline in Kuwait and the Middle East. It was established in Kuwait in 2004 as a public shareholding company after the Kuwaiti Government broke the 50 year monopoly, opening the sector for private entrants.

The airline operates brand new Airbus A320 aircraft, maintained by leading international aviation engineering companies. The aircraft is fitted with leather seats comfortably seating 165 passengers, who can enjoy ample leg space and real TV entertainment. Travelers also have the choice of purchasing a wide selection of food and beverages onboard.

According to Boodai, the airline's unique business model enables it to maximize cost efficiency through electronically integrated operations and innovative booking and ticketing systems as well as operating a fleet of single type aircraft. Boodai also stressed on the company's strict safety policies - a commitment that lead them to partner with Lufthansa Technik, one of the leading aircraft maintenance companies. The airline only recruits pilots with a minimum of 5000 hours flight experience.

About Jazeera Airways (K.S.C)
Jazeera Airways is a Kuwait Public Shareholding Company established in 2004 with a capital of KD 10 million raised through an Initial Public Offering, making it the only privately owned airline in the Middle East. Based on a low fare business model that maximises across the board efficiency in operations, Jazeera Airways enables travellers to fly without a ticket and book through the web and SMS, giving travellers more independence, spontaneity, and fares up to 50% less than market.

Jazeera Airways' fleet of new A320 aircraft flies to some of the most popular destinations for both business and leisure in the Middle East , including Dubai, Beirut, Bahrain, Damascus, Amman, and Egypt and India to follow. Passengers are able to book via jazeeraairways.com, travel agents or call or SMS the Jazeera Airways reservation number 177 ( or *177# for SMS) to receive a booking reference number for easy, ticket-free check in.
